UTG (OTCMKTS:UTGN) Stock Price Crosses Above 50 Day Moving Average - Here's What Happened

UTG logo with Finance background

UTG, Inc. (OTCMKTS:UTGN - Get Free Report) crossed above its 50 day moving average during trading on Friday . The stock has a 50 day moving average of $29.78 and traded as high as $30.83. UTG shares last traded at $29.95, with a volume of 600 shares traded.

UTG Stock Performance

The stock has a market capitalization of $94.82 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 2.08 and a beta of 0.16. The stock has a fifty day moving average of $29.80 and a two-hundred day moving average of $28.09.

UTG (OTCMKTS:UTGN -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, March 26th. The insurance provider reported $2.34 earnings per share for the quarter. UTG had a net margin of 58.34% and a return on equity of 25.58%.

About UTG

(Get Free Report)

UTG, Inc, an insurance holding company, provides individual life insurance products and services in the United States. Its individual life insurance includes servicing of existing insurance business in-force; the acquisition of other companies in the insurance business; and the administration processing of life insurance business for other entities.
